Waves, an open source blockchain platform, and The Abyss, a blockchain game distribution platform, will collaborate to develop a blockchain-based marketplace of in-game items and digital goods.

As per the data in the blog post published on September 5th, The Abyss noted that their integration with the Waves Platform aims at launching a marketplace powered by blockchain for in-game goods and tradable items. This marketplace will purportedly allow the users to buy items using the Abyss Tokens and further sell them to other users.

Waves blockchain-integrated tokens

The partnership of Waves Blockchain and Abyss Tokens will enable the game developers to implement Abyss Tokens operations into their Waves-based games directly. The CEO and founder of Waves Platform, Sasha Ivanov, commented on this initiative saying:

“We recognize the huge potential of the $100+ billion gaming sector as a major use case for blockchain which perfectly fits with current gameplay mechanics and trading of goods. We strongly believe that the gaming industry will be an enthusiastic adopter of blockchain, and partnership with The Abyss will drive its widespread use.”

Previous collaborations

Earlier in spring, The Abyss announced a collaboration with Epic Games (the developer of the popular game Fortnite) to enable access to the Unreal Developer Network to the developers on their platform. A spokesperson explained the partnership saying:

“The program is aimed at attracting more gaming studios and titles to The Abyss platform, as well as supporting Unreal Engine developers in cryptocurrency adoption. More specifically, they will be able to accept ABYSS tokens both for game and in-game purchases in legal and easy-to-use way.”

Later in June, Waves also launched an upgrade to its blockchain system that allows decentralized applications, or dAPPs, on the platform. This upgrade allowed the developers to carry out calculations required for applying on the Waves Blockchain.
